Soon after the successful piloting the "Clean Cambodia Campaign" in the communes of Preah Theat, Mean, and other communes in Ou Raing Ov District, Tbong Khmum province, the Ministry of Environment will officially launch the "Clean Cambodia! Khmer Can Do!" Campaign on 15th May 2024. His Excellency Dr. Eang Sophalleth, Minister of Environment, stated that the "Clean Cambodia! Khmer Can Do!" campaign is a new initiative that goes hand in hand with that "Today, I Do Not Use Plastic Bag," which was started on 1st September 2023, involing more than 8 million students and people across Cambodia.H.E. Minister stressed that launching the "Clean Cambodia! Khmer Can Do!" campaign clearly shows that Cambodia has managed to prevent the use of more disposals of plastic bags than their littering in public spaces.The "Clean Cambodia! Khmer Can Do!" campaign is the initiative to encourage students, monks, and villagers in village or commune or district or province to altogether do cleaning and collect garbage around their homes, schools, pagodas, and the publc areas for at least 15 minutes every Saturday with proper collection, management and disposal. Solid waste management is part of people’s attitudes and behaviors, reflecting individual actions and norms in their society.His Excellency Dr. Eang Sophalleth expressed his support for the environmental cleanup movement through the "Clean Cambodia! Khmer Can Do!" campaign, aiming to rejuvenate grassroots efforts weekly to promote cleanness, environment and the beauty of local areas for a cleaner, pollution-free Cambodia and the gradual elimination of plastic wastes from the country in the future.It should be noted that in accordance with the "Pentagonal Strategy" Phase 1 and based on the national existing laws, policies, strategies, as well as relevant international conventions, the Ministry of Environment has developed the "Circular Strategy 2023-2028," focusing on three strategic themes: clean, green, and sustainable. The strategy aims to guide and prioritize efforts to ensure environmental sustainability and perfection in respond to climate change, and promotion of green economy.

Phnom Penh, May 09, 2024 --The Asia Low Carbon Buildings Transition (ALCBT) project was officially launched here on May 8, aiming to achieve a nationwide transition towards low carbon buildings, contributing significantly to the lower energy consumption and greenhouse gas emission reduction in building sector in Cambodia.According to a news release of the German Embassy in Phnom Penh, prior to the COVID-19 pandemic, Cambodia's economy experienced a transformation with an annual growth rate of 7 percent, which led to a boom in the building and construction industry. In 2019, buildings encompassing the residential, commercial, and public sectors accounted for an astounding 43 percent of the nation's total energy consumption. The electricity demand for all sectors is forecasted to increase 6 times at 66 TWh by 2040 without energy efficiency compared to baseline in 2020. In the National Energy Efficiency Policy 2022-2030 (NEEP), the government has set national targets of energy saving by 19 percent of total consumption, and 34 percent and 25 percent in residential and commercial buildings, respectively, by 2030.H.E. Say Samal, Deputy Prime Minister and Minister of Land Management, Urban Planning, and Construction acknowledged, "While Cambodia is relatively new to green building concepts, we recognise the opportunity for eco-friendly and energy-saving in building and construction sector, which could boost growth in the sector and contribute to Cambodia’s commitment to achieve carbon neutrality in 2050 under the Paris Agreement on Climate Change. Therefore, this project will be an instrumental in developing the Low Carbon Tool to support this vision."This five-year project, funded by the German Federal Ministry for Economic Affairs and Climate Action (BMWK) under the International Climate Initiative (IKI), aims to facilitate a nationwide transition to Low Carbon Buildings (LCBs) in Cambodia and four other Asian countries (India, Indonesia, Thailand, and Vietnam). Global Green Growth Institute (GGGI) is leading implementation of ALCBT project along with other consortium partners i.e. ASEAN Centre for Energy (ACE), Energy Efficiency Services Ltd. (EESL), and HEAT International. In Cambodia, the Ministry of Land Management, Urban Planning, and Construction is the government counterpart of the project."Cambodia's booming building sector, driven by stable economic growth, contributes significantly to electricity consumption and greenhouse gas emissions," stated H.E. Stefan Messerer, German Ambassador to Cambodia. "This IKI-funded project is a crucial step in helping Cambodia unlock the full potential of green buildings."Under the project, GGGI and other local partners aim to institutionalise low-carbon performance metrics, enhance industry stakeholder capacity, link building performance to financing options, and share best practices to promote project replication and scaling.Ms. Helena McLeod, Deputy Director-General of GGGI, said, "GGGI has been supporting Cambodia in its green growth journey. So far, we have supported the government for sustainable energy practices in the garment sector, electric mobility, waste management, as well as carbon financing. As for green building, the sector also offers a win-win situation for Cambodia. ALCBT project will help reduce energy consumption and greenhouse gas emissions by and create healthier and more comfortable living and working environments for Cambodians."The project aims to contribute to 1.68 million tCO2eq direct and indirect GHG emission reduction (combined for all project countries) while mobilising €140 (USD XY) million (or US$150 million) worth of investment. In Cambodia, the project will support two policy recommendation outputs (building code enhancement and targets o carbon emissions reduction) to be adopted by the government and eight private and public sector entities to incorporate ALCBT project tools and training programmes.

Cambodia’s Exports Jump 15 Percent In First 4 Months

Phnom Penh, May 10, 2024 --Cambodia exported a total of US$8,005 million worth of goods in the first four months of this year, up 15.2 percent from US$7,606 million recorded in the same period last year, showed the data from the General Department of Customs and Excise on Friday.The Kingdom’s imports rose by 9.3 percent to US$8,664 million, read the report.According to the same source, the bilateral trade between Cambodia and its trade partners was amounted to US$16,670 million during the January-April period, a 12.1 percent year-on-year increase.The U.S. was the biggest market for Cambodia’s exports with a total of US$2,617 million, followed by Vietnam and China with US$1,713 million and US$486 million, respectively.H.E. Penn Sovicheat, Secretary of State and Spokesperson of the Ministry of Commerce, said that the implementation of the Cambodia-China Free Trade Agreement and the Regional Comprehensive Economic Partnership (RCEP) added momentum to the country’s export growth.“Despite the war crisis and weakening of the purchasing power, Cambodian orders remained high, with the volume of orders remaining unchanged, although there was a decline in some items, but an increase on other items,” he said.The markets in the RCEP members are huge for Cambodia’s products, underlined the spokesperson.

11,622 Voters Registered For Capital, Provincial, Municipal, District And Khan Councils Election

Phnom Penh, May 11, 2024 --The National Election Committee has finalised the updated list of 11,622 voters for the 4th Election of Capital, Provincial, Municipal, District, and Khan Councils on May 26.H.E. Hang Puthea, an NEC member, chaired here on May 10 a meeting to conclude the update, adding that the voters will cast their ballots at 209 assigned stations across Cambodia.The assigned team, he added, will start distributing voter information cards from May 11 to 15.Eligible voters can visit the NEC website voterlist.nec.gov.kh and the mobile app “NEC KH” to check for the same information.H.E. Hang Puthea called on concerned local authorities at all levels, participating political parties, relevant civil society organisations, the media, and other stakeholders to carry out their respective professional and responsible roles to make the election run smoothly.

Cambodian Women's Team Expects To Excel At 2024 Women Indoor Hockey Asia Cup

Phnom Penh, May 10, 2024 --A Cambodian women team expects to excel at the 2024 Women's Indoor Hockey Asia Cup, to be held from May 13 to 16 in Thailand.The optimism was shared by Mr. Kang Sothea, Secretary General of the Cambodian Hockey Federation (CHF), stressing that the Cambodian women's team has accumulated sufficient experience to achieve it.He added that they joined a friendly hockey match in Saraburi province of Thailand in February and the SEA Games 2023 in Cambodia, winning two bronze medals.If the team achieves a good result, they will have an opportunity for the forthcoming Asian Martial Arts.Ten (10) countries are expected to join the tournament, and Cambodia will be in group B with host Thailand, Singapore, Indonesia, and Vietnam, according to Mr. Kang Sothea.Group A includes Iran, Kazakhstan, Malaysia, Nepal, and Oman, he added.This is the second time the Cambodian women team has participated in the event. Last year, Cambodia was ranked second among the 12 participating countries.

Cambodian PM Heading For Laos For Two-Day Official Visit

Phnom Penh, March 25, 2024 --A high-level Cambodian delegation led by Prime Minister Samdech Moha Borvor Thipadei HUN Manet is on the way to the Lao PDR for a two-day official visit, at the invitation of H.E. Dr. Sonexay SIPHANDONE, Prime Minister of the Lao PDR.The delegation was seen off at Phnom Penh International Airport by deputy prime ministers, senior ministers and many other senior government officials as well as H.E. Buakeo Phumvongsay, Lao Ambassador to Cambodia.According to a press release of the Ministry of Foreign Affairs and International Cooperation, during the visit on Mar. 25-26, Samdech Thipadei will pay a courtesy call on H.E. Thongloun SISOULITH, President of the Lao PDR, and hold bilateral talks with his counterpart, Prime Minister Sonexay SIPHANDONE to discuss elevating bilateral cooperation across a wide range of fields. They will also exchange views on sub-regional, regional and international issues of common interest and concern. The meeting will be followed by the signing of several documents.Samdech Thipadei is scheduled to receive a courtesy call by H.E. Khambai DAMLAT, President of the Lao-Cambodian Friendship Association. He will also meet Cambodian Business Club members and Cambodian students.“The visit will further deepen bilateral cooperation under the spirit of good neighbourliness, traditional friendship, and the comprehensive and long-lasting strategic partnership between the two countries. At the same time, it will strengthen foundations for growth and prosperity for the benefit of the two peoples,” stressed the press release.

Cambodian PM Leaves For High-Level Opening Of UN-ESCAP’s 80th Session In Bangkok

Phnom Penh, April 22, 2024 --Samdech Moha Borvor Thipadei Hun Manet, Prime Minister of the Kingdom of Cambodia, departed here this morning for Bangkok, Thailand to attend the high-level opening of the eightieth session of the Economic and Social Commission for Asia and the Pacific (ESCAP).The Premier was seen off at Phnom Penh International Airport by deputy prime ministers, senior ministers, and many other senior government officials.According to the Ministry of Foreign Affairs and International Cooperation, at the invitation of H.E. Dr. Armida Salsiah Alisjahbana, Under-Secretary-General of the United Nations and Executive Secretary of the ESCAP, Samdech Thipadei Prime Minister will deliver a special address at the high-level opening of the eightieth session of the Commission.Under the theme "Leveraging digital innovation for sustainable development in Asia and the Pacific", the annual session will deliberate about the potential of digital technology and ways to strengthen regional cooperation in addressing emerging global challenges and accelerate the achievement of the Sustainable Development Goals.Samdech Thipadei Hun Manet is accompanied by H.E. Sok Chenda Sophea, Deputy Prime Minister and Minister of Foreign Affairs and International Cooperation, H.E. Ly Thuch, Senior Minister and President of the National Committee for ESCAP, and H.E. Chea Vandeth, Minister of Post and Telecommunications, along with key government officials.

Undersecretary of State, Ministry of Commerce, led a Cambodian delegation to the 6th Round of ACFTA 3.0 Negotiations in Singapore.

(Singapore): On 22 to 26 April 2024, in Singapore, His Excellency TITH Rithipol, Under Secretary of State of Commerce, and the ACFTA JC Lead for Cambodia led Cambodia’s delegation to attend the 6th Round of the ACFTA 3.0 Upgrade Negotiations in order to monitor the progress as well as discuss and address the issues and follow-up works under the ACFTA 3.0 Upgrade Negotiations to ensure achieving a substantial conclusion by the end of 2024.On that sideline, some relevant working groups’ meetings were also organized, such as the Working Groups on Trade in Goods, Customs Procedures and Trade Facilitation, Investment, Digital Economy, Green Economy, Legal and Institutional Issues, and Supply Chain Connectivity. As a result, The 6th Round was successfully concluded, and the ACFTA JC agreed to organize its 7th Round in June 2024 in China.
